Average Costs in San Francisco
Electrician service calls typically cost $50–$100, with hourly rates between $50–$100/hr. Outlet installation runs $150–$350, panel upgrades cost $1,500–$4,000, and whole-house rewiring ranges from $8,000–$15,000.
California Licensing Requirements
Electricians must hold a valid state or local license. Journeyman electricians complete a 4–5 year apprenticeship. Master electricians have additional experience and can pull permits. Always verify licensing — electrical work by unlicensed workers can void your insurance.
Questions to Ask Before Hiring
- Are you licensed, bonded, and insured?
- Will you pull the necessary permits?
- Do you offer a written estimate?
- What is your experience with this type of work?
- Do you warranty your work?
Tips for Finding the Right Contractor
Never hire an unlicensed electrician — bad electrical work is a fire hazard. Ask if the job requires a permit (most do). A good electrician explains code requirements and won't cut corners to save time.
